The phrase "are arbitrarily assigned"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when discussing the allocation or designation of items, roles, or values without a specific or systematic method.
Example: "In this experiment, the participants are arbitrarily assigned to either the control group or the experimental group to ensure unbiased results."
Alternatives: "are randomly designated" or "are assigned without criteria".
